Unlocking Athletic Potential: Discover Mindfulness Through Meditation

Mindfulness meditation session with calm water background for athletes.

Finding Your Center: The Importance of Mindfulness in Sports

In the fast-paced world of sports and outdoor activities, the pressure to perform can be overwhelming. Athletes and enthusiasts alike sometimes need to pause, reconnect, and reset. Mindfulness offers a powerful tool for this very purpose. Kimberly Brown's gentle meditation practice serves as a reminder that taking a break can significantly enhance performance and overall well-being.

Why Mindfulness Matters: The Science Behind Meditation

Research has shown that practices like meditation can lead to improvements in focus, emotional regulation, and resilience. Studies indicate that athletes who integrate mindfulness meditation into their training routines often experience decreased anxiety and enhanced concentration. This can translate into better performance in high-pressure situations. The act of turning inward, as suggested in Brown’s meditation, allows individuals to cultivate an understanding of their mental and emotional states, promoting a healthier, more balanced approach to both competition and recreation.

Practical Steps to Incorporate Mindfulness

To reap the benefits of mindfulness, start by setting aside just a few minutes a day. Brown’s meditation emphasizes simple but effective techniques, such as using physical sensations to anchor your awareness. By placing your hands on your heart and belly, and focusing on your breath, you can cultivate a sense of presence and reduce the tension that often accompanies athletic endeavors. This practice can easily be integrated into a busy day, whether it's before a hike, during a break in training, or in the moments before a significant competition.

Turning Distraction into Advantage: Mindfulness Techniques for Enhancing Sports Focus

Update Unlocking Focus: Harnessing Distraction for Enhanced Concentration For many athletes and outdoor enthusiasts, maintaining focus during training or exhilarating hikes can be a challenge, especially when distractions threaten to derail your performance. However, recent insights from mindfulness practices, particularly guided meditation, reveal a surprising approach: using distraction as a tool to sharpen focus. In this exploration, we’ll delve into how understanding and redirecting attention can enhance your mental clarity in both sports and outdoor activities. Understanding Distraction: The Key to Sharpened Focus In a world filled with constant stimuli, it’s easy to become overwhelmed. But instead of pushing distractions away, meditation teacher Toby Sola advocates for embracing them. Sola introduces what he terms the “concentration algorithm,” where practitioners can identify the types of distractions that capture their attention. By redirecting focus onto these distractions—be it sounds, sights, or thoughts—athletes can develop deeper concentration and resilience. Practical Techniques: Meditation for Mental Clarity This technique is especially potent in sports. Athletes can practice guided meditation sessions that require them to acknowledge their distractions and focus on them. For instance, if you're distracted by a bustling environment during a hike, instead of letting that distract you completely, practice zoning in on the specific sounds around you. Are you focusing on the rustling leaves or distant chatter? Doing so can train your mind to maintain clarity and calm amidst external chaos. Benefits of Mindfulness in Outdoor Activities Integrating mindfulness into sports and outdoor activities not only improves focus but also enriches experiences. Studies show that mindfulness practices enhance performance by reducing anxiety and increasing presence in the moment. This is crucial for athletes prepping for competitions or individuals simply seeking to enjoy nature. Incorporating guided meditation into pre-training rituals can set a positive, focused mindset, leading to better performance outcomes. The Science Behind Distraction and Focus Research in cognitive psychology supports the idea that our brains are wired to respond to distractions. A notable study found that when subjects allowed distractions to enter their awareness and then redirected their focus, their cognitive flexibility improved. For athletes, this translates into better adaptability—essential during unpredictable outdoor activities or dynamic sports conditions. Incorporating Guided Meditation into Your Training To get started with guided meditation, athletes can choose a specific time each day to practice, preferably before training sessions or during rest periods. Apps and online resources provide accessible options where you can listen to guided sessions that emphasize focusing on distractions. As you begin to practice, remember that it’s okay to encounter mental noise. Rather than trying to erase these thoughts, welcome them, observe, and redirect your energy toward your breath or surrounding sounds, cultivating a serene state of mind.
